
Lightning Burns Hoops for Fourth Time
January 5, 2003 - Continental Basketball Association 2 (CBA 2)
Grand Rapids Hoops News Release
The Grand Rapids HOOPS fell victim to the Rockford Lightning's high-octane offense for the fourth time this season, 127-115 at the Rockford MetroCenter.
Alex Scales scored 14 of his 26 points in the fourth quarter, but it was not nearly enough to overcome a 33-16 first-quarter thrashing. Jerald Honeycutt also registered 26 points of his own, while Larry Ayuso added 21.
The first quarter once again spelled doom for Grand Rapids, as Rockford used a 17-3 run to close the quarter to take a 17-point lead. The HOOPS were slow to find their shooting touch as they shot a dismal 7-20 (.350) in the first frame.
Grand Rapids (10-12) was not able to overcome the sloppy play in the second quarter to cut into Rockford's lead. They trailed 62-46 at halftime, as the two teams combined for 31 turnovers.
Rockford (14-6) rode another large 14-4 run to take the third quarter from the HOOPS, as they dominated both the offensive and defensive boards. For the game, the Lightning held a 65-52 rebounding advantage, including 23 on the offensive end.
The HOOPS finally found their shooting range in the final frame, but it was too little too late. They sank 13 of 23 shots in the fourth, but they were not able to dwindle Rockford's lead until the final minutes. Scales, Honeycutt, and Immanuel McElroy combined to score 29 of Grand Rapids' final 30 points, but Albert White hit some clutch shots down the stretch to salvage the lead.
Seven players scored in double-figures for the conference-leading Lightning, including three players who registered double-doubles. Ronnie Fields led the way with 26 points and ten rebounds, while White added 20 points and 12 boards. Livan Pyfrom also registered 12 points and 11 rebounds for Rockford.
Grand Rapids will face Great Lakes on Tuesday at 7:05 p.m. at the DeltaPlex Arena.
